Mission
BRENTWOOD SCHOOL CIO is a registered UK charity (1153605) working in children & youth in CM15 8EE. CharityCompare scores the organisation from public Charity Commission annual accounts — financial efficiency, transparency, and filing compliance — not programme outcomes.
In short: BRENTWOOD SCHOOL CIO scores 87 out of 100 (3 stars). 88% average program spend (3-year average). Filings are up to date with no major concerns.
Overview
BRENTWOOD SCHOOL CIO has a Clarity Score of 87 out of 100 on CharityCompare (3 stars, Good). Charity Commission registration number 1153605. Status: Registered. Primary cause area: Children & youth. Latest accounts year 2021: total income £34m, with 88% of expenditure on charitable activities. Accounts filing: up to date. Reserves: approximately 17 months of operating costs. No major red flags from our filing review. Scores are independent and based on official filings — not a donation recommendation.

How we score charities +
The Clarity Score is a 100-point rating from UK Charity Commission data. Four pillars — Accountability & Transparency (40), Financial Health (30), Financial Efficiency (20), and Community Support (10). A statutory inquiry sets the score to 0 automatically.
Accountability & Transparency
Scored from filings
40 points — filing history (15), trustee oversight (15), declared policies (10).
Financial Health
Scored from filings
30 points — reserves (15), income stability (10), liabilities to assets (5).
Financial Efficiency
Scored from filings
20 points — program expense ratio (10), fundraising efficiency (10). Kept at 20% to avoid punishing legitimate infrastructure costs.
Community Support
Scored from filings
10 points — volunteer-to-staff ratio from Charity Commission workforce data.
Overall score
Sum of all pillar points. Translated to stars: 90–100 Exceptional (4★), 75–89 Good (3★), 60–74 Needs improvement (2★), below 60 Poor (1★).
